What is the purpose of ECU tuning for a car?
2 Answers
ECU tuning essentially involves modifying the database. Its purpose is to alter the data controlling the engine, thereby influencing the engine's operation to achieve desired effects within the engine's tolerable limits. The ECU (Engine Control Unit) is the car's computer, and tuning it can either enhance or reduce engine power. Below is an introduction to ECU-related aspects: 1. Areas ECU can influence: The operation of a car's engine is controlled by the ECU. The ECU regulates the engine's air intake, fuel injection quantity, ignition timing, etc., thereby determining the engine's operational efficiency, power, torque, and more. 2. Principle: Information such as air intake, fuel injection quantity, and ignition timing corresponding to various engine speeds, gears, loads, temperatures, etc., is recorded in the ECU in the form of a database. This database is referred to as the "M.A.P."
